Just wondering if anyone has any experience of this situation.

I have a number of broad matched high volume keywords. These have been running absolutely fine for about a year now. Since last weekend the impressions and subsequently the clicks have dropped to about half to a third of the previous levels. From doing searches it appears the my ads are not now showing for the broad terms such as 'blue widget' 'red widget' etc. I am surprised by this as the click rate is still really strong and no different than it was historically. With the exception of increasing the CPC the account has not been changed in any way.

I have checked the usual things such as daily budget etc but just can't figure out why this might be happening. Any advice gratefully received.

from what you have said this could be happening.

by increasing your CPC and not increasing your daily budget it WILL show less immpressions and clicks. as you are paying more per click it uses the daily budget quicker therefore decreasing the no of impress/clicks you can get for the same daily budget.

are you still reaching you daily budget limit each day?
